Transaction 1ec894ea2dba321d5cabe63013c4fb776eb476151946ca637a0d1f62da4862e4
1 Input
1 Output
-
1ec894ea2dba321d5cabe63013c4fb776eb476151946ca637a0d1f62da4862e4:0
- value
- 57153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a83d2598dd4af55b50227e5019c3d05baf4a3da OP_EQUAL
- address
- 3HEciHXXCArBz8qwjXQ3vZpWnq3FXr3CMW